【问题标题】:Python docx module ModuleNotFoundErrorPython docx 模块 ModuleNotFoundError
【发布时间】:2020-05-16 07:30:52
【问题描述】:

我是 Windows 7 用户,使用 MS-Office 2016 和 python 3.6。
我最近发现你可以用python写word文档。 我看了how to do that 我安装了 docx 模块:

pip install docx

但是每当我尝试导入 docx 模块时,我都会收到此错误:

>>> from docx import Document
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
  File "C:\Users\Huzefa\AppData\Local\Programs\Py
in <module>
    from exceptions import PendingDeprecationWarn
ModuleNotFoundError: No module named 'exceptions'

我什至试过这个,但它不会工作:

pip install exceptions

我收到此错误:

ERROR: Could not find a version that satisfies the requirement exceptions (from versions: none)
ERROR: No matching distribution found for exceptions

我认为这可能是因为 docx 是一个 python-2 模块,但它不是。我发现了here

谁能告诉我我做错了什么?

【问题讨论】:

    标签: python python-3.x ms-word python-docx modulenotfounderror


    【解决方案1】:

    我建议你可以这样尝试——

    $ pip install --pre python-docx
    

    或者你也可以试试sudo命令-

    $ sudo pip install --pre python-docx
    

    之后尝试-

    from docx import Document
    

    从这里你可以找到 [https://python-docx.readthedocs.io/en/latest/user/install.html][1]

    【讨论】:

      【解决方案2】:

      尝试使用:

      pip install python-docx
      

      它对我有用!

      【讨论】:

        猜你喜欢
        • 2023-03-28
        • 2019-12-23
        • 2018-01-23
        • 2022-01-11
        • 2020-01-12
        • 1970-01-01
        • 2020-08-15
        • 1970-01-01
        • 1970-01-01
        相关资源
        最近更新 更多